"I don't understand this cost report at all," exclaimed Jeff Mahoney, the newly appointed adminis-
trator of Mountainview General Hospital. "Our administrative costs in the new pediatrics clinic are al
over the map. One month the report shows $8,300, and the next month it's $16,100. What's going on?"
Mahoney's question was posed to Megan McDonough, the hospital's director of Cost Manage-
ment. "The main problem is that the clinic has experienced some widely varying patient loads in its first
year of operation. There seems to be some confusion in the public's mind about what services we offer
in the clinic. When do they come to the clinic? When do they go to the emergency room? That sort of
thing. As the patient load has varied, we've frequently changed our clinic administrative staffing."
Mahoney continued to puzzle over the report. "Could you pull some data together, Megan, so we
can see how this cost behaves over a range of patient loads?"
